Basically, he may be saying these internet speed test sites are "unreliable" because you are traveling over the internet to get the speed test and there are many things in that path that may slow you down that have nothing to do with your ISP. In my opinion, this is partially correct, but these internet speed tests can still be used as a gage of your speeds. Some ISP's have their own speed tests, see if they have one. If not, maybe they should get one so you do actually have a "reliable" way to test your speeds without traveling over the internet. In my experiences, the speed you get from your ISP's own speed test will not be much different than most internet speed tests.
